Wonderfalls
Wonderfalls was a television series on Fox, created by Bryan Fuller (Dead Like Me) and Todd Holland (Malcolm in the Middle) with executive producer Tim Minear (writer and director for Firefly and Angel). Some sources use the two-word spelling Wonder Falls for the title, although it is correctly a single word (but note the title of its theme song, below). The series is a United States/Canada co-production, filmed in Toronto, Ontario and with several Canadian actors cast in lead roles (including the show's star).
Planned episodes
Although the series creators had intended for the 13 episodes of Wonderfalls to tell a standalone story (perhaps anticipating cancellation after the first season), apparently the writers were already thinking as much as two years ahead. According to an interview featured on the 2005 DVD release of the series, the producers revealed that they already had plans for the third season, which would have begun with Jaye being institutionalized with "Jesus Syndrome."
